Data overview and usage
This dataset contains gauge measurements, primarily water surface elevation (WSE) time series, from more than 1,200 lake gauges across nine countries, compiled through an international collaborative effort (Table 1). Most records overlap at least part of the period from July 2023 to May 2025, and some records extend beyond this window. Temporal coverage, continuity, and sampling frequency vary among lakes and regions.
This dataset was compiled to support validation of the Heuristic Adaptive Lake Filter (HALF) for SWOT vector lake products, as reported in Trudel et al. (2026, in review). It is released here as a companion dataset to the HALF code package and is intended to support the validation workflow implemented in half_v1_validation.py. The HALF code package is available through the GitHub repository at https://github.com/LARIC-jw…, and the archived v1.0 code release is available through Zenodo at https://doi.org/10.5281/zen….
Users may also use this gauge-data collection for other relevant research and applications, provided that the dataset is properly cited (see Citation) and that use complies with the terms and conditions of the original data sources. This release represents version 1.0 of the dataset.
Detailed information on regions, countries, lake counts, temporal frequency, and data sources is summarized in Table 1. Overall, the included lakes span a wide range of sizes, from approximately 0.01 km2 to more than 57,000 km2.
Additional details on data access, preprocessing, formatting, and source-specific considerations are provided in the log files within each regional data folder. Further processing and validation details are available in Trudel et al. (2026, in review).
Table 1. Description of the collected lake gauge data
|
Region |
Lake (PLD) count |
Temporal frequency |
Data sources |
|
Canada |
282 |
Hourly |
Environment and Climate Change Canada (ECCC), Centre d'expertise hydrique du Québec (CEHQ), Hydro-Québec (HQ), and University of Sherbrooke |
|
US |
284 |
Hourly |
U.S. Geological Survey (USGS) and U.S. Bureau of Reclamation (USBR) (Harlan et al., 2026) |
|
Norway |
232 |
Hourly |
Norwegian Water Resources and Energy Directorate (Norges vassdrags-og energidirektorat (NVE)) |
|
Switzerland |
29 |
Hourly |
Swiss Federal Office for the Environment (Bundesamt für Umwelt (BAFU)) |
|
China |
38 |
Daily (inconsecutive) |
China Water and Rain Information website (http://xxfb.mwr.cn/sq_dxsk.…) |
|
Burkina Faso |
1 |
Sub-hourly to hourly |
Specifically in situ set-up for SWOT cal/val (Girard et al. 2025) |
|
Niger |
1 |
Sub-hourly to hourly |
Analyse Multidisciplinaire de la Mousson Africaine - Couplage de l’Atmosphère Tropicale et du Cycle Hydrologique (AMMA-CATCH) observatory (Girard et al. 2025) |
|
Amazonia, Brazil |
6 |
Daily to hourly |
Instituto Mamirauá, Brazil |
|
Ceará, Brazil |
8 |
Sub-hourly |
Ceará Institute of Meteorology and Water Resources (Funceme) |
|
Other Brazil |
63 |
Daily |
Operador Nacional do Sistema Elétrico (ONS; https://www.ons.org.br) |
|
India |
304 |
Daily (inconsecutive) |
Water Resources Information System of India (https://indiawris.gov.in/wr…), containing in situ data from multiple agencies (Central Water Commission (CWC), Andhra Pradesh Water Resources Information and Management System (APWRIMS), and Government of Gujarat (Gujarat)). |
|
Total |
1,248 |
